CCTV Operators are mainly responsible for operating and maintaining surveillance equipment, watching both live and recorded video surveillance footage, reporting incidents or suspicious behavior and contacting the authorities when necessary.

CCTV Operators can be employed at shopping malls, schools, housing complexes, gated communities, hospitals, airports and many other types of establishments.

Dear Hiring Manager,

I am writing to express my interest in the entry level CCTV Operator position at your esteemed organization. With a strong passion for security and surveillance, I am confident in my ability to contribute to the safety and protection of your premises.

Although I am new to the industry, I have completed a comprehensive training program in CCTV operations and have gained hands-on experience through internships. I possess a solid understanding of video surveillance systems, alarm monitoring, and incident reporting. My attention to detail, ability to multitask, and quick decision-making skills make me a suitable candidate for this role.

I am eager to join your team and contribute to maintaining a secure environment. Thank you for considering my application. I look forward to discussing how my skills and enthusiasm align with your organization's goals.

Dear Hiring Manager,

As an experienced CCTV Operator with a proven track record in maintaining the security and integrity of various establishments, I am excited to apply for the CCTV Operator position at your organization. With my expertise in surveillance systems and my dedication to ensuring safety, I am confident in my ability to make a significant contribution to your team.

Over the past five years, I have successfully operated and monitored CCTV cameras, conducted regular system checks, and responded promptly to any security breaches. I am well-versed in analyzing footage, identifying suspicious activities, and collaborating with law enforcement agencies when necessary. Additionally, I have a strong understanding of industry regulations and best practices.

My exceptional attention to detail, ability to remain calm under pressure, and excellent communication skills have consistently allowed me to excel in my previous roles. I am confident that my experience and expertise make me an ideal candidate for this position.

Thank you for considering my application. I am eager to discuss how my skills and qualifications align with your organization's needs. I look forward to the opportunity to contribute to your team's success.

There's no one-size-fits-all cover letter. Every cover letter should be tailored to the requirements of a particular job. Therefore, resist the temptation of using these samples word-for-word in your job applications. They're only intended to serve as a guide for writing compelling cover letters.

Since each job comes with its unique responsibilities and requirements, it's important to customize your cover letter to align with the specific skills and expertise demanded by the position you are applying for, highlighting why you are a strong match for the job requirements.
